Output 3fc5c4b44837126523156aeb21a15ebbc1ac281796f12fa08f4174fefecdde6a:51

value
491388
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d7114e0a30b8c017da5ea25a71e16f0188cc411a OP_EQUALVERIFY OP_CHECKSIG
address
1LcB1c6bFCV4s4GFQq4PYki5XpBFSWp17R
transaction
3fc5c4b44837126523156aeb21a15ebbc1ac281796f12fa08f4174fefecdde6a
spent
true